Pl@za
based Short Messaging Service Included in Mobile Portal
An
operator- and hardware-independent mobile portal, Port Alma, was
opened on 30 April in Finland providing access to Alma Media's news,
information, entertainment and experience services. The new portal,
based on WAP and SMS services, will also operate in GPRS and UMTS
environments. Alma Media is Finland's leading provider of new media
content.
Decode, Teamware
Group’s affiliate, has created the SMS services which are financed
by advertising and, thus, free-of-charge for the end users.
The user can
choose what news services to receive from news headlines, NHL and
Formula1 news, recipes, horoscopes, music and entertainment. The
service is based on profiling and personalizing agent technology
used by Decode. This provides users to receive one advertisement
a day in addition to the subscibed service. The users can choose
the topic of the advertisement as well as the time of day it is
sent to them.
The SMS service
is built on the Teamware Pl@za platform which is connected to Alma
Media’s AHAA database with over 513 000 registered users. The new
mobile portal is available to all customers of teleoperators operating
in Finland.
